Robin Plitt performing at the 1991 Florida Folk Festival (Old Marble Stage)

General Note/Comment

  • One reel to reel recording. Murray served as the emcee. Plitt, from Lake Worth, wrote and sang songs about Florida's past. Joined on the last four songs by Marie Nofsinger on guitar.
